Bill Payment Service. This service is available for all accounts except time deposit accounts. The Client may request this service by checking the appropriate box in the Account Application at the time an account is established or by making a specific written request at any time thereafter. The Bank then will pay, from time to time, bills that you specify to us in an acceptable written form and will debit your account for the amount of each such bill that the Bank pays on your behalf. The Bank will also debit your account for the applicable service charge which is then in effect, and which the Bank may change from time to time. You understand that in performing this service the Bank may make the bill payments by check or funds transfer (which may be through an automated clearing house), that the Bank will be acting as your agent in making such payments on your behalf, and that all such payments will be subject to applicable Florida and federal law and to all applicable rules and operating procedures. You agree that the Bank shall have no obligation to review invoices, make inquiries, or take any other action for the purpose of determining independently the amount of a required payment, the name or address of a payee, or any other information relating to a requested bill payment. Without limiting the generality of the foregoing, in the event you wish us to make future payments in amounts that are not now known (e.g., you wish us to pay a property tax bill each year), a written request must be made at the time the amount required to be paid (and all other relevant information) is known. You also agree that the Bank is under no obligation to comply with your bill payment instructions if the designated account does not have sufficient funds available at the time of requested payment. If there are insufficient funds available in your designated account on the date a payment is requested, we will be under no obligation to attempt to complete the payment on subsequent business days. Generally, payments will be processed on the date specified in your bill payment instructions. If, however, you specify a date which falls on a Saturday, Sunday, or holiday, the payment will not be processed until the next business day. You must allow sufficient time for your payment to reach its destination. Bill Payment Service. You can arrange, at your option, for the payment of your current, future and recurring bills from your designated Bill Pay Account. For Bill Payment Service, your Payee list may include utility companies, merchants, financial institutions, insurance companies, individuals, etc. within the United States whom you wish to pay through Bill Payment Service. Please include the full name of the Payee and a complete mailing address and telephone number for each Payee, along with your account number with the Payee, the amount of the Payment, and whether the Payment is recurring. The Bank reserves the right to decline to make Payments to certain persons and entities. You agree that any Payment for taxes, Payments that are court-ordered, government payments and Payments outside of the United States are prohibited and you agree that you will not attempt to use any Service to make these types of Payments. On recurring Payments, it is the responsibility of the account owner or designated authorized users to update Payee account information such as address changes, account numbers, etc. Payments are posted against your ledger balance, plus the available credit on your overdraft protection, if any, or other line of credit. You may schedule Payments to be initiated on the current Business Day, on a future date, or on the same date of each month. If you are scheduling a Payment for the current day it must be initiated prior to 3:00 p.m. C.S.T. Changes to previously scheduled Payments must be made before midnight C. S. T. the Business Day before the day it is to be initiated. Bank may, in its sole discretion, accelerate the effective time of any scheduled Payments or change requests. If the transaction is no longer showing a "Scheduled Payments" status, then the Payment cannot be modified or deleted. Although you can enter Payment information through the Service twenty-four (24) hours a day, seven (7) days a week, the Bank only initiates on Business Days. Funds must be available in your Account on the scheduled payment date. After funds are withdrawn from your Account to make a Payment, we may make the Payment either by transferring funds electronically to the Payee or by mailing the Payee a check. Bill Payment Service. The bill payment service may be used to schedule the payment of funds from Customer’s checking and money market Accounts to Payees that have been selected to receive payment using the service. The service allows bill payments in several ways: • An immediate payment is a single transfer of funds to a Payee to be initiated as soon as possible after the transfer request is submitted. • A recurring payment is one of a series of transfers of a fixed amount of funds to a Payee on a regular, periodic basis. • A future-dated payment is a single transfer of funds to a Payee to be made on a date Customer specifies up to 364 days in advance. • A payment that is made following the receipt of an electronic bill (“e-bill”). Bill payments made through the System require sufficient time for the Payee to credit Customer’s account properly. To avoid the assessment of late charges by the Payee, Customer should make the payment at least five (5) Business Days before the due date of the payment. Payment requests submitted on a Business Day before 7:30 p.m. (Eastern Time) Monday through Thursday and 10:30 p.m. (Eastern Time) on Friday are initiated on that Business Day, provided a sufficient Available Balance. Transactions conducted after those times on a Business Day or at any time on a non-Business Day are initiated on the next Business Day, subject to a sufficient Available Balance in the Account from which the payment is being made. Bank cannot guarantee prompt receipt and processing of payments by Xxxxxx and will not be responsible for any charges imposed or other action taken by a Payee because of a late payment, including but not limited to finance charges and late fees. BANK MAY TERMINATE ACCESS TO THE BILL PAY SERVICE AFTER SIX (6) CONSECUTIVE MONTHS OF INACTIVITY.
Bill Payment Service. Bill Payment Account Designation; Payment Details. When using the Bill Payment Service, Client must designate the Account (“Bill Payment Account”) from which the bill payments (“Bill Payments”) are to be made. For each Bill Payment, Client will also be required to provide the complete name of the payee, the account number and the payee’s remittance address (as exactly as shown on the billing statement or invoice), the amount of the payment and the date Client wants the payment to be processed by Bank (“Pay Date”). If the Pay Date is not a business day, then the Bill Payment will be processed by Bank the next business day. To have a Pay Date that is the same date Client accesses the System and initiates the Bill Payment instruction, the Bill Payment instruction must be received by Bank on a business day, prior to the Bill Payment Service cutoff hour. The availability of this option may vary based on the payee. Setting-Up Payees. When Client signs onto the Bill Payment Service, Client must establish Client’s list of payees. A payee is anyone, including Bank, that Client designates to receive a Bill Payment; provided that Bank accepts the payee for the Bill Payment Service. Bank reserves the right to reject any payee at any time, at its discretion. Bank is not responsible if a Bill Payment is not made to a payee because Client provided Bank with incomplete, incorrect or outdated information regarding the payee or Client attempted to make a payment to a payee that is not on Client’s authorized list of payees. Payments to payees outside of the United States or its territories are prohibited through the Bill Payment Service.

Bill Payment Service. Ebanking Bill Payment service ("Bill Payment") is an electronic payment system that permits you to initiate and authorize payments from your account to payees that you have selected in advance to receive payments by means of this service. (A "payee" is a person or business you are paying.) You have the option of setting up a payee as one of two bill payment types: (1) recurring payments, which are payments of a fixed amount that are paid at a regular time interval, such as monthly (e.g., rent, mortgage, etc.); and (2) single payments, which are payments that vary in amount and/or date (e.g., utility, credit card, etc.). We use a third party processor, iPay Technologies LLC ("Bill Payment processor"), for Bill Payment. The Bill Payment processor provides customer support for questions and issues regarding Bill Payment processing such as researching payments, payment posting, adding payees, etc. To subscribe to Bill Payment, you must have a checking account with the Bank and complete the appropriate application form. Your access to Bill Payment is subject to our approval. We reserve the right to deny access to Bill Payment based upon our policies in effect, your account history, or your credit history. If you are approved, you may use Bill Payment to make payments from one checking account designated by you as your account to debit for Bill Payment ("Primary Account"). An account that requires two or more signatures to make withdrawals may not be designated as a Primary Account.
